Abstract

A method for forming an outside layer on a curved surface and a kit for the same purpose is disclosed. The method here is achieved by following steps: (a) providing an assembling kit containing a first set and a second set; (b) assembling the first set and a second set together to form an outside layer on the curved surface. The first set of the assembling kit is consisting of a central hexagon and three pentagons. The second set illustrated above is consisting of one binding hexagon and two peripheral hexagons. As the first set and the second set is combined together, only one edge of the central hexagon is next to one edge of each binding hexagon.
